Title :
A flash-based multimedia interactive tutoring system for distance education of biomedical engineering students: new approach to teaching microcontroller-based systems

Abstract :
In this paper, we present new tutoring system teaching biomedical engineering students the basic concept of internal and external operations of a microcontroller, which is necessary to understand modern microcontroller-based biomedical equipment. The developed tutoring system utilized multimedia contents and maximized the interaction with students for distance education. It also provides movie clips, graphic animations, narrations as well as graphic and text. Movie clips were produced by using WinCam and graphic animations were implemented by using FLASH MX and ActionScript, GIF graphic files and Power Point techniques. This tutoring system includes the basic concept of microcontroller-based system, entire execution process for the each instruction of the instruction set, development of small-sized programs, understanding of operations, control of built-in peripherals and design techniques of simple application programs.
